Campus Student Support Assistant Our welcoming Perth Campus is seeking a Campus Student Support Assistant to join our team on a full-time, permanent basis, commencing in Term 2, 2026. The Campus Tucked amidst a blend of commercial and residential properties, just a short 20-minute journey from Perth CBD, you''ll discover our OneSchool Global Perth Campus. Boasting both Primary and Secondary areas, complete with separate lush playing fields and equipment, our campus is equipped with stateoftheart facilities and firstrate technology to support both online and facetoface learning for both our primary and secondary students. The learning spaces are thoughtfully crafted to inspire innovation and create a forwardlooking environment for all students. Embracing an intimate school vibe, we provide individualised attention to our 161 students spanning from Year 3 to Year 12. Responsibilities - Work oneonone with a student with a disability to enable full participation in classroom and educational activities. - Liaise efficiently with classroom teachers and campus learning support teachers. - Maintain accurate learning records and support documentation. Qualifications - Certificate III or Certificate IV in Education Support, with relevant experience. - Current Working with Children Check (WWCC) required.
